The New Mexico Ice Wolves are a Tier III junior ice hockey team in the North American 3 Hockey League. The Wolves play their home games in the Outpost Ice Arenas in Albuquerque, New Mexico.

After the completion of the 2021-22 season, it was announced that the North American Hockey League's Wichita Falls Warriors would be relocating to Oklahoma City and the Blazers Ice Centre, beginning play as the Oklahoma Warriors in the 2022-23 season.[2] Following this announcement, the New Mexico Ice Wolves secured the rights to an NA3HL franchise,[3] and later confirmed the purchase of the Oklahoma City Ice Hawks.[4] the franchise moved to Albuquerque and took the same name as their new parent club.[5]
